I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C Discussion :

Ecrire dans plusieurs cases d'un tableau en une fois


Sujet :

C

  1. #1
    Nouveau membre du Club
    Inscrit en
    Septembre 2007
    Messages
    53
    Détails du profil
    Informations forums :
    Inscription : Septembre 2007
    Messages : 53
    Points : 36
    Points
    36
    Par défaut Ecrire dans plusieurs cases d'un tableau en une fois
    Bonjour,

    Je voudrais écrire un int (32 bits) dans un tableau de char.
    Comment puis-je faire pour que le code binaire de l'int s'étale sur plusieurs cases du tableau pour me permettre de le remplir très rapidement en char ?

    exemple :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
     
    unsigned int nb = 456...123; // entier codé sur 32 bits
    char tab[4];
    tab[0] = nb //ne marche évidemment pas, c'est la que je bloque. 
    // Peut être mettre un void* à la place du char...
    Et je dois avoir tab[0] tab[1]... tab[3] qui sont des caractères.

    Merci d'avance pour vos conseils
    Charlie

  2. #2
    Membre émérite Avatar de nicolas.sitbon
    Profil pro
    Inscrit en
    Août 2007
    Messages
    2 015
    Détails du profil
    Informations personnelles :
    Âge : 41
    Localisation : France

    Informations forums :
    Inscription : Août 2007
    Messages : 2 015
    Points : 2 280
    Points
    2 280
    Par défaut
    Voir la fonction memcpy().

  3. #3
    Nouveau membre du Club
    Inscrit en
    Septembre 2007
    Messages
    53
    Détails du profil
    Informations forums :
    Inscription : Septembre 2007
    Messages : 53
    Points : 36
    Points
    36
    Par défaut
    OOO, ça me parait super.
    Merci pour ta réponse rapide.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[PHP 4] Ecrire dans plusieurs onglets d'un fichier tableur
    Par pitoumad dans le forum Langage
    Réponses: 2
    Dernier message: 23/07/2010, 11h26
  2. Réponses: 7
    Dernier message: 21/11/2009, 22h00
  3. Ecrire dans plusieurs feuilles Excel
    Par soufian1364 dans le forum C#
    Réponses: 4
    Dernier message: 23/03/2009, 10h50
  4. Changement simultané dans plusieurs cases d'un tableau
    Par olihya dans le forum Collection et Stream
    Réponses: 6
    Dernier message: 29/12/2008, 14h41
  5. ecrire dans plusieur fichier
    Par Rocket2005 dans le forum VB 6 et antérieur
    Réponses: 4
    Dernier message: 11/01/2006, 21h19

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o